High-pressure die casting
Because of the high pressure used in aluminum high pressure die casting when pouring – up to 1,200 bar – the bolts must have a high locking force that holds the two halves of the die together.

Cold-chamber die casting machines are mainly used for aluminum alloys because these have a relatively high melting point. Here, at the exterior side of melt, the zinc investment casting china assembly is placed. To a shot chamber the molten metal is input, from where the metal is driven into the die by a piston. The two parts of the die are opened once the metal has cooled and solidified and by ejector pins the casting is automatically ejected from the die.
